The data acquisition system based on AVR microprocessor

Jun Niu

Open publisher page 0 citations

Abstract

The AVR microprocessor possesses richer I/O ports and rapid-responsed external interrupts,in particular,SPI module.The new AVR microprocessor-based data acquisition system includes signal conditioning circuit,AD conversion circuit and data transfer circuit.Better performances with high efficiency,capacity and reliability are expected.
